What Is Assisted Living?
Assisted living is a senior care arrangement where older adults receive support with daily routines — meals, bathing, dressing, medication, and companionship — while living in a residential setting rather than a hospital or nursing ward.
In Singapore, assisted living typically suits seniors who are still fairly independent but should not be living alone without supervision. Residents have their own room, join a small community, and receive professional care tailored to their individual needs — without the clinical feel of a nursing home.

Who Is Assisted Living Suitable For?
Assisted living may be the right choice if your parent or loved one is in one of these situations:
Feels lonely or unsafe living alone at home
Needs help with daily meals, grooming, or getting around
Is becoming forgetful with medications or daily routines
Is still mobile but benefits from supervision and structure
Has a chronic condition — diabetes, hypertension, mild dementia — that requires monitoring
Is recovering from a hospitalisation or surgery and needs more support than family can provide at home
Does not yet need the intensive nursing care of a nursing home

Assisted Living vs Nursing Home in Singapore
Many families searching for a nursing home or old folks home in Singapore find that assisted living is a better match for their parent's current situation. Here is how the two differ.
| Blue Atria (Assisted Living) | Nursing Home | |
|---|---|---|
| Setting | Home-like residence, 8–12 residents | Institutional ward, 30–100+ beds |
| Care level | Daily support & 24/7 caregivers with regular nursing | High-dependency medical and nursing care |
| Room type | Private or shared ensuite rooms | Shared bay or ward |
| Daily life | Structured activities, social outings, family visits | Limited; varies by facility |
| Family access | Open visiting, warm and flexible | Typically scheduled visiting hours |
| Subsidies | AIC-approved; subsidies available | MOH-subsidised where eligible |
| Best for | Seniors needing support, companionship & daily care | Seniors with complex medical needs |
Assisted Living Costs in Singapore
Assisted living fees in Singapore vary depending on the care level required, room type (single or shared), and the specific residence. As a licensed AIC-approved provider, Blue Atria residents who are Singapore Citizens or Permanent Residents may be eligible for government subsidies through MOH and AIC assistance programmes.
Subsidies are determined through a financial means test based on household income. Our care coordinators can walk you through the full process — from the initial assessment to understanding what monthly subsidised fees may look like for your family.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is assisted living in Singapore?
Assisted living in Singapore is a residential care arrangement for seniors who need support with daily activities — such as meals, bathing, dressing, and medication management — but do not require the intensive medical care of a nursing home. Residents live in a structured, home-like environment with 24-hour caregiver support and regular licensed nursing visits.
Is assisted living the same as a nursing home in Singapore?
No. Assisted living focuses on daily living support, companionship, independence, and quality of life. Nursing homes in Singapore are generally suited for seniors with complex medical needs requiring hospital-level or intensive nursing care. Assisted living is a more home-like, community-centred option for seniors who need meaningful support without full medical dependency.
